Benjamin Franklin is unquestionable one of the most iconic figures in early American history. From his political influence to his contributions to scientific knowledge, Benjamin Franklin will always be known as a foundational figure to the United States. Life of Ben Franklin is the most complete abridged biography (preface) of Ben Franklin taking extensively from Benjamin Franklins famous Autobiography with information around his childhood, character, trade, Philadelphia paper, experiments with electricity, passages from England to America and back with the Stamp Act and other tax laws, Boston Tea-party, member of congress, signing the Declaration of Independence, letter to Washington, and much more.

WELD, Hastings H.; FROST, John
Life of Benjamin Franklin: embracing anecdotes illustrative of his character, with embellishments.
New York : Derby & Jackson, 1859.
Details:
Collation: Complete with all pages
xvi, [2], 549, [1]
Language: English
Binding: Hardcover; secure
Brown cloth
Size: ~9.25in X 6.25in (23.5cm x 15.5cm)
